Hi, I am new in ActiveMQ, and try to get the following scenario working: I have external system, lets call it SysA. I have my own systems, lets call it SysB, SysC and so on. SysA is already fault tolerant, active/active etc, and is capable to communicate with multiple peers. My systems (SysB, SysC, SysN) are mutually independent and all have to communicate with SysA. I want to put SysA interfacing logic in separate module, let's call it SysA adapter. It will be stateless "gateway" module. It also has to be fault tolerant. I have experience with buses where multiple instances of the program can publish the same data, and subscribers will automatically get only one copy of the message (according to priorities between publishers or some other logic), allowing active/active publishers setup without any coding, just by configuration. So, if I were using such bus, I'd put two instances of SysA adapter on different physical hosts, they would communicate with SysA simultaneously, and publish incoming data on the bus. SysB, SysC etc would get each message only once. Is it possible to get the same net effect on ActiveMQ, even if with some coding ? I don't want to invent, test and certify "home brew" high availability solution from scratch. P.S. Obviously ActiveMQ itself has to be deployed using one of the high availability modes, this question is about how I protect myself against failure of the SysA gateway, not the failure of ActiveMQ engine.
